OLD FASHION STACK CAKE | |
3 1/2 c. flour 1 tsp. salt 1/2 tsp. baking soda 2 tsp. baking powder 1/2 c. shortening 1/2 c. sugar 1 c. molasses 2 eggs 1 c. buttermilk 1 tsp. vanilla 3 c. cooked dried apples or thick applesauce 1 tsp. ginger (optional) Mix flour, salt, soda and baking powder; set aside. Cream shortening. Add sugar and molasses and beat well. Add flour mixture and buttermilk alternately. Pour batter 3/8-inch thick in greased and floured pans. Makes 4 to 5 layers. Bake at 375°F for 18 to 20 minutes. When cool, stack, using cooked dried apples or thick applesauce between layers. |
